import java.text.ParseException; import java.util.Map; /** * Contains helper functions for converting graph settings strings into their native setting object * types. */ public final class CViewSettingsGenerator { /** * You are not supposed to instantiate this class. */ private CViewSettingsGenerator() { } /** * Turns a settings string value into a boolean value. * * @param rawSettings Map of settings strings. * @param settingName Name of the settings string to convert. * @param defaultValue Default value in case conversion fails. * * @return The converted settings value. */ private static boolean createBooleanSetting( final Map<String, String> rawSettings, final String settingName, final boolean defaultValue) { final String settingString = rawSettings.get(settingName); if (settingString == null) { return defaultValue; } else { try { return Boolean.parseBoolean(settingString); } catch (final NumberFormatException exception) { CUtilityFunctions.logException(exception); return defaultValue; } } } /** * Turns a settings string value into an enumeration value. * * @param <T> Type of the returned enumeration value. * * @param rawSettings Map of settings strings. * @param settingName Name of the settings string to convert. * @param defaultValue Default value in case conversion fails. * @param parser Parser used for setting conversion. * * @return The converted settings value. */ private static <T> T createEnumerationSetting(final Map<String, String> rawSettings, final String settingName, final T defaultValue, final IParser<T> parser) { final String settingString = rawSettings.get(settingName); if ((settingString != null) && Convert.isDecString(settingString)) { // ESCA-JAVA0166: Catch Exception because a listener function is called try { return parser.parse(Integer.parseInt(settingString)); } catch (final Exception exception) { CUtilityFunctions.logException(exception); return defaultValue; } } else { return defaultValue; } } /** * Turns a settings string value into a double value. * * @param rawSettings Map of settings strings. * @param settingName Name of the settings string to convert. * @param defaultValue Default value in case conversion fails. * * @return The converted settings value. */ public static double createDoubleSetting( final Map<String, String> rawSettings, final String settingName, final double defaultValue) { final String settingString = rawSettings.get(settingName); if (settingString == null) { return defaultValue; } else { try { return Double.parseDouble(settingString); } catch (final NumberFormatException exception) { CUtilityFunctions.logException(exception); return defaultValue; } } } /** * Turns a settings string value into an integer value. * * @param rawSettings Map of settings strings. * @param settingName Name of the settings string to convert. * @param defaultValue Default value in case conversion fails. * * @return The converted settings value. */ public static int createIntegerSetting( final Map<String, String> rawSettings, final String settingName, final int defaultValue) { final String settingString = rawSettings.get(settingName); if ((settingString != null) && Convert.isDecString(settingString)) { try { return Integer.parseInt(settingString); } catch (final NumberFormatException exception) { CUtilityFunctions.logException(exception); return defaultValue; } } else { return defaultValue; } } /** * Creates the graph settings for a given view. * * @param view The view whose graph settings are generated. * * @return A pair of raw settings and the generated graph settings object. * * @throws CouldntLoadDataException Thrown if the view settings could not be loaded. */ public static Pair<Map<String, String>, ZyGraphViewSettings> createSettings(final INaviView view) throws CouldntLoadDataException { final ZyGraphViewSettings defaultSettings = view.getGraphType() == GraphType.CALLGRAPH ?
